Gutter rerouting services involve adjusting the path of existing gutters to improve water flow away from a property’s foundation. This process typically includes disconnecting the current gutter system, repositioning or extending the gutters, and installing new downspouts where needed. The goal is to ensure rainwater is directed efficiently and safely away from the home, reducing the risk of water damage and foundation issues. Skilled service providers can customize rerouting solutions to fit different property layouts, making sure the system functions properly during heavy rains and throughout the year.

Many properties benefit from gutter rerouting when existing systems are causing problems. Common issues include water pooling near the foundation, overflowing gutters during storms, or gutters that are improperly pitched. These problems can lead to basement flooding, soil erosion, or damage to landscaping. Rerouting can also address issues caused by obstructions or trees that interfere with the original gutter placement. Homeowners who notice water marks on exterior walls or pooling around the foundation may find that rerouting the gutters helps resolve these concerns effectively.

Properties that often require gutter rerouting include older homes with outdated drainage systems, homes built on uneven terrain, or properties with landscaping that has shifted over time. Commercial buildings and multi-unit residences may also need rerouting to manage larger volumes of water or complex roof structures. In some cases, renovations or additions to a property can alter the natural flow of rainwater, making rerouting necessary to maintain proper drainage. The overview below groups typical Gutter Rerouting proj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Johnstown, OH.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for routine gutter rerouting projects in Johnstown, OH, range from $250 to $600. Many common jobs fall within this range, covering minor adjustments or rerouting sections of gutter systems. Larger or more complex repairs can push costs higher but remain less frequent.

Partial Rerouting - For moderate projects involving rerouting several sections of gutters, local contractors generally charge between $600 and $1,500. This range accounts for more extensive work while still being a common price band for standard rerouting tasks.

Full Gutter System Rerouting - Complete rerouting of an entire gutter system typically costs between $1,500 and $3,500. Many homeowners in the area encounter projects in this range, though larger or more intricate jobs can go beyond this spectrum.

Large or Complex Projects - Larger, more involved gutter rerouting projects, such as rerouting multiple levels or dealing with challenging rooflines, can reach $5,000 or more. These projects are less common and usually involve significant structural considerations or custom solutions.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
